SMT32 Systick 中断优先级分析 SMT32 Systick 中断优先级分析是一篇关于STM32微控制器中Systick中断优先级的分析文章。该文章详细介绍了Systick中断优先级的概念、设置方法和优先级分析。 知识点1:Systick中断优先级属于内核中断,优先级由Systemhandler priority registers (SHPRx)来设置。SHPRx寄存器可以设置内核中断的优先级,从0到15共16个可编程的优先等级。 知识点2:timer、串口等外设中断的优先级由Interrupt priority registers (NVIC_IPRx)来设置。NVIC_IPRx寄存器可以设置外设中断的优先级,从0到15共16个可编程的优先等级。 知识点3:STM32微控制器有16个可编程的优先等级,使用了4位中断优先级。该4位优先级可以在Systemhandler priority registers (SHPRx)和Interrupt priority registers (NVIC_IPRx)中设置。 知识点4:Systemhandler priority registers (SHPRx)可以设置内核中断的优先级,从0到15共16个可编程的优先等级。 知识点5:Systick配置函数中包含中断优先级的设置,使用NVIC_SetPriority函数设置Systick的中断优先级。该函数将Systick的中断优先级设置为最低的15级。 知识点6:在对外设中断优先级设定时,需要使用NVIC_Init函数将外设优先级设置为主次优先级。在该函数中,可以选择不同的优先级组,例如NVIC_PriorityGroup_1、NVIC_PriorityGroup_2和NVIC_PriorityGroup_3等。 知识点7:不管选择哪种优先级组,4bit优先级总是意味着优先级的范围从0到15。高 PriorityGroup 位就是抢占优先级,低 4 - PriorityGroup位就是亚优先级。 SMT32 Systick 中断优先级分析文章详细介绍了Systick中断优先级的概念、设置方法和优先级分析,为开发者提供了充分的知识储备。
































- 粉丝: 5
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 网络电视(IPTV)技术在北京石景山鲁谷小区的应用.doc
- 网络游戏账号交易协议书范本.doc
- 办事处项目管理手册.doc
- 企业认证抄报综合数据采集系统.ppt
- 某小区宽带网络工程施工竣工文档.docx
- 函数的连续性和运算法则.ppt
- (人脸识别考勤)基于SpringBoot Vue线上教学系统 java毕业设计,基于微信小程序,基于安卓App,机器学习,大数据毕业设计,Python+Django+Vue ,php ,node.js
- 同轴电缆网络.pptx
- 通信维护个人年度考核总结5篇.docx
- 网络化财务管理整体性案例XX0423.ppt
- 机器学习研究及最新进展.ppt
- 最新国家开放大学电大《人体生理学(专)》网络核心课形考网考作业及答案.pdf
- 本科设计基于AVR单片机的数据采集系统设计.doc
- 网络营销的市场环境.ppt
- 基于WEB构建的财富快车电子商务系统决赛方案.doc
- 大学生与网络的社会调查报告docdoc.doc


